WHAT MAKES ALMOND EYES PERFECT FOR FLARED LASHES

Almond eyes are wider in the middle and taper softly at the corners. That shape is exactly why flared lashes look so good on almond eyes. A flared lash repeats the curve of your natural eye, so it looks like a real lash line, only more defined.

I did not always get this right. Early on, I bought a heavy cat-eye lash with one long strip and wondered why my almond eyes looked closed. The problem was not my eye shape. It was the placement of the longest lash fibers.

The good news? You can get the almond-eye lift without over-lifting the outer corner. The fix is to choose flared lashes that put the longest length near the center of your iris.

THE 3 FLARE STYLES THAT WORK WITH ALMOND EYES

  • Center flare (doll eye): The longest fibers sit in the middle. This makes almond eyes look rounder, younger, and more awake.
  • Wispy flare: A crisscross mix of 8mm to 12mm fibers. It adds texture without making the eye look heavy.
  • Cat-eye flare: The longest fibers sit at the outer third. It creates drama, but keep the outer length around 12mm to 13mm so it does not pull your eye too far.

HOW TO PLACE FLARED LASHES ON ALMOND EYES

  1. Hold the lash against your eye before applying.
  2. Match the longest part of the flare with the highest point of your eye arch.
  3. Press the inner corner first, then the middle, then the outer corner.
  4. Blink once. If the lash lifts away from the inner corner, press it down for 5 more seconds.

WHAT TO LOOK FOR IN A FLARED LASH KIT FOR ALMOND EYES

Not every flared lash works on almond eyes. Here is what I check before buying:

  • Multiple lengths in one strip, usually 8mm to 14mm
  • A thin, flexible band that can curve around the eye
  • Lightweight fibers that stay lifted all day

If a lash pack uses the same length across the whole strip, it will not create the shape almond eyes need.

WHAT FLARE STYLE IS BEST FOR ALMOND EYES?

A center flare or a wispy flare usually works best. The longest hairs sit near the middle, which mirrors the curve of an almond eye.

CAN I WEAR CAT-EYE LASHES WITH ALMOND EYES?

Yes. Cat-eye lashes can make almond eyes look more dramatic. Keep the outer length around 12mm to 13mm so the outer corner does not pull too far up.

HOW LONG SHOULD FLARED LASHES BE FOR ALMOND EYES?

Most almond eye shapes look balanced with lengths from 8mm at the inner corner to 13mm at the outer edge.
